Now this is what I've been talkin about! How long I've been trying to get the "counter makers" to realize that large graphics infringe upon the terrain effects.

I like the ships and plane silhouettes, but how about the NATO emblems for the ground units. No need for the counter base, or make the base transparent.

Make the NATO sprites like we see in the historical deployment maps, only the emblems are necessary with the appropriate size(XX, X, XXX etc.), strength, national color, and tech upgrades.

I've thought of doing that and still get the itch to try it out from time to time.

But I haven't done it because it's a lot of work and will probably be (1) very easy to for the eye to lose the nato symbols in the map terrain, (b) it might be difficult to differentiate all but primary colors and (c) the aircraft silhouettes would probably be too out of step with the ground unit symbols and need to change too. That aside, I still might give it a go someday - especially now that I know someone else is interested. Maybe on that "bleached map" mod it would work well.
